PAS Selangor belum tentu terima Anwar sebagai MB The Malaysian Insider


PAS Selangor tidak semestinya menerima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im sebagai menteri besar (MB) malahan akan meletakkan wakilnya sekiranya Tan Sri Abdul Khalid Ibrahim melepaskan jawatan tersebut, kata Mohd Khairudin Othman.
Menurut setiausaha PAS Selangor itu, selagi tidak timbul isu penggantian menteri besar, parti Islam itu hanya menjadi pemerhati sahaja.
"Namun sekiranya berlaku kekosongan pada jawatan MB, maka PAS Selangor akan mengambil bahagian dalam menentukan siapa calon yang akan diterima oleh rakyat dan PAS Selangor akan turut menghantar senarai calon MB yang dirasakan layak dan sesuai.
"Ini termasuk menamakan Pesuruhjaya PAS Selangor Iskandar Samad sebagai calon utama kita," katanya dalam satu kenyataan.
Kenyataan dikeluarkan selepas sidang media PKR pagi tadi yang turut disertai wakil PAS dan DAP yang memaklumkan Anwar akan bertanding di kerusi Dewan Undangan Negeri (DUN) Kajang selepas dikosongkan.
Semalam bekas Ahli Dewan Undangan Negeri (Adun) Kajang Lee Chin Cheh meletakkan jawatan kerana dikatakan mahu memberi laluan kepada Anwar yang mahu menggantikan Abdul Khalid sebagai menteri besar Selangor.
Menurut Mohd Khairudin, pihaknya mengikuti perkembangan politik di Selangor secara langsung dan berhati-hati.
"Kita akan menghantar nama ini untuk pertimbangan PAS Pusat dan terserah kepada kepimpinan pusat untuk menentukannya kemudian. Mengapa kita hantar calon kita? Kerana kita juga memiliki kerusi terbanyak dalam DUN," katanya.
"Apa pun keputusan kita dalam Pakatan Rakyat (PR) kita yakin ia mestilah membawa kepada kestabilan kerajaan negeri Selangor yang dipimpin oleh PR," katanya.
PKR hari ini mengesahkan akan meletakkan Anwar sebagai calon bagi kerusi DUN Kajang yang dikosongkan oleh Lee semalam.
Keputusan itu diumumkan oleh Abdul Khalid di Ibu Pejabat PKR di Petaling Jaya, Selangor hari ini.
"Parti Keadilan dan Pakatan Rakyat setuju meletakkan calon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im yang akan bertanding di Kajang," kata Abdul Khalid. – 28 Januari, 2014.

Selangor PAS to step in if Anwar makes a move for MB

KUALA LUMPUR, Jan 28 — Selangor PAS vowed to stay clear of the Kajang by-election today, but pledged to step in should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im make a move for the state mentri besar post.
Should the post be vacated, Selangor PAS will nominate state party commissioner Iskandar Abdul Samad for the job, since the Islamist party holds more seats in the state assembly than Anwar’s PKR does.
“PAS Selangor will not intervene. As long as it has nothing to do with the Selangor mentri besar (job) PAS will stay as an observer,” Selangor PAS secretary Mohd Khairuddin Othman said in a statement here.
If the mentri besar post becomes vacant, Selangor PAS will step in, he said.
“This includes naming Selangor PAS commissioner as our main candidate.”
Iskandar, the state assemblyman for Cempaka, could not be reached for further comment.
The Pakatan Rakyat coalition holds 44 of the 56 seats in the Selangor state assembly, PAS and DAP both have 15 seats each, while PKR has 13 after Kajang assemblyman Lee Chin Cheh’s sudden resignation yesterday.
In a separate statement, Selangor PAS Youth expressed disappointment over Lee’s resignation, calling it a betrayal against public trust since Lee had won by a 6,824-vote majority last year.
Its chief Syarhan Humaizi Abdul Halim claimed that internal squabbles within PKR should have been settled without wasting public funds in a by-election.
“The resignation seems to only give way for Anwar to contest, as announced by Selangor Mentri Besar Tan Sri Khalid Ibrahim.”
Opposition Leader Anwar announced today that he will contest the upcoming Kajang by-election, confirming previous widespread speculation. He did not say if he planned to replace Khalid as Selangor Mentri Besar.

MB Terengganu ‘kantoi’ guna istana untuk lawatan ke Antartika The Malaysian Insider


Usaha Menteri Besar Terengganu, Datuk Seri Ahmad Said (gambar) menggunakan nama istana bagi lawatan ke Antartika terbocor apabila Yayasan Diraja Sultan Mizan (YDSM) menafikan penglibatan mereka dalam ekspedisi berkenaan.
Ahmad Said dituntut segera membuat permohonan maaf kepada Tuanku Sultan Mizan atas tindakan berkenaan.
"Kita menuntut Ahmad Said memohon maaf kepada YDSM dan menyebutkan siapakah sebenarnya yang menganjurkan lawatan beliau itu dan berapa kos sebenar lawatan itu," kata Adun Batu Burok, Dr Syed Azman Ahmad Nawawi.
YDSM pada Ahad menafikan mereka menjadi penganjur kepada lawatan Ahmad Said ke Antartika.
"Lawatan itu bukan anjuran YDSM dan ia tiada kaitan dengan program yayasan," kata Setiausaha Kerja YDSM, Mohd Azrul Ismail dalam satu kenyataan.
Pejabat Menteri Besar Terengganu mengumumkan lawatan 15 hari pada 16 Januari lalu, atas anjuran Kementerian Sains, Teknologi dan Inovasi dengan kerjasama YDSM.
Kenyataan itu turut menyebut lawatan kerja berkenaan bertujuan membantu kerajaan dalam menubuhkan pusat kajian bersama Instituto Antarctico Chileno.
“Lawatan ini membantu Malaysia dalam kajian perubahan iklim yang sejak akhir-akhir ini menjadi semakin tidak menentu.
“Lawatan eksplorasi saintifik ini merupakan lawatan susulan Sultan Terengganu, Sultan Mizan Zainal Abidin ke Antartika pada Oktober 2011 dalam usaha melihat lebih banyak universiti tempatan terlibat dalam kajian di sana,” kata kenyataan itu.
Timbalan Pesuruhjaya PAS Terengganu, Yahaya Ali, berkata isu penganjur bukan perkara pokok kerana lawatan ke Antartika itu tidak membawa pulangan.
"Ketika kita ajak rakyat berjimat, menteri besar pula dilihat mahu menghabiskan duit tanpa faedah. Apa faedah rakyat Terengganu terima daripada lawatan ke Artartika. Kita bukan hadapi salji, yang kita hadapi adalah banjir," kata Yahaya kepada The Malaysia Insider.
Ahli Parlimen Kuala Nerus, Datuk Dr Mohd Khairuddin Aman Razali, berkata dua perkara memerlukan penjelasan daripada kerajaan negeri Terenganu khususnya menteri besar iaitu amanah dan  bercakap benar yang sepatutnya menjadi etika setiap pentadbir dan pemerintah.
“Penggunaan dana milik rakyat untuk suatu aktiviti yang dipertikaikan keperluan dan kemunasabahannya mengundang persoalan amanah kerajaan negeri dalam menguruskan harta milik awam,” katanya.
Sebelum ini, DAP turut mempertikaikan lawatan kerja Ahmad Said dengan menyifatkan ia sebagai satu “pembaziran besar” yang tidak bertepatan dengan keadaan rakyat yang sering diingatkan untuk “mengikat perut”.
Setiausaha Publisiti Kebangsaan DAP, Tony Pua mempersoalkan rasional di sebalik lawatan 15 hari yang akan diketuai oleh Ahmad Said itu.
“Bagaimana lawatan 15 hari menggunakan kapal persiaran mewah memberi faedah kepada Malaysia? Jika saintis Malaysia terlibat dalam kajian perubahan iklim, mereka boleh mengkaji kesan pembalakan yang berlaku di Malaysia.
“Mengapa kita perlu membelanjakan wang pembayar cukai kepada kajian yang tidak membawa cabaran kompetitif,” katanya.
Syed Azman berkata, bukan sekadar lawatan kerja ke Antartika itu mengejutkan, penafian penglibatan YDSN ini lagi mengejutkan rakyat.
"Ini satu pembohongan kepada seluruh rakyat," katanya kepada The Malaysian Insider.
Sehubungan itu, katanya, beliau yakin rakyat Terengganu tidak akan membiarkan pembohongan sebegini didiamkan begitu saja.
"Saya yakin rakyat, tanpa mengira latar belakang politik, tidak akan membiarkan perkara ini begitu saja," kata Syed Azman yang juga AJK PAS Pusat itu.
Kedudukan Ahmad Said sentiasa tidak stabil sejak mula dilantik sebagai menteri besar selepas pilihan raya umum 2008 lalu.
Ini kerana, kepimpinan Umno memilih Datuk Seri Idris Jusoh untuk meneruskan jawatannya sebagai menteri besar namun pihak istana tidak mahukannya.
Selepas beberapa sesi rundingan, akhirnya Ahmad Said yang bersetuju dilantik menjadi menteri besar dalam keadaan menerima bantahan daripada Umno sendiri sehingga pihak istana digelar sebagai "natang" iaitu istilah untuk binatang mengikut loghat Terengganu.
Apabila Tuanku Sultan Mizan dilantik sebagai Yang Dipertuan Agung, satu Dewan Pangkuan Di Raja Terengganu (DPDRT) dibentuk bagi menggantikan baginda kerana anakanda baginda masih terlalu muda untuk menjadi pemangku sultan.
Sehubungan itu, Ahmad Said terpaksa bertanggungjawab bukan kepada seorang raja bahkan sembilan anggota DPDRT dalam mentadbir Terengganu.
Ia menimbulkan pelbagai persepsi kerana banyak projek dan kawasan balak serta lombong  terlepas daripada tangan rakyat biasa kepada pihak tertentu.
Selepas pilihan raya umum 5 Mei lalu, kedudukan Ahmad Said semakin tidak stabil berikutan PR hanya kurang dua kerusi untuk menyamai kerusi BN.
Dalam pilihan raya itu, PAS mendapat 14 kerusi manakala PKR mendapat satu kerusi manakala BN pula menguasai majoriti 17 kerusi. - 28 Januari, 2014.


Terengganu MB must apologise for his ‘Antartica lie’, says PAS lawmaker




Terengganu Menteri Besar Datuk Seri Ahmad Said has been told to apologise to the state royalty for falsely claiming that his upcoming Antartica trip is sponsored by the Yayasan Diraja Sultan Mizan (YDSM).
Batu Burok assemblyman Syed Azman Ahmad Nawawi (pic) said the MB should apologise immediately to the YDSM and also to the Terengganu's Sultan Mizan Zainal Abidin for using his name.
"We demand that he (Ahmad) apologise to YDSM and reveal who is actually the organiser or his trip and how much it is costing us," Dr Syed Azman said.
Yesterday, YDSM shot down Ahmad's claims and denied that it had organised the trip.
"The trip was not organised by us and has nothing to do with the foundation's programmes," said its working secretary, Mohd Azrul Ismail, in a statement.
On January 16, the MB's office announced the Antartica trip claiming that it was organised by the Science, Technology and Innovation Ministry through the initiative of YDSM.
It said the working visit was aimed at paving the way to assisting the government to set up a research station there for joint research with the Instituto Antarctico Chileno.
"The visit is initiated to enable Malaysia to contribute to research on climate change which has become increasingly unpredictable.
"This scientific exploration visit is a follow-up to the visit by the Sultan of Terengganu to Antarctica in October 2011, in wanting to see more local universities involved in research in the ice-covered region," the MB’s office said in a statement.
Opposition leaders were outraged at the MB's trip, calling it "blatant extravagance" after the rising cost of living had caused the people to tighten their belts.
"Why should we be spending any taxpayers’ money at all to 'research' an area in which we have no competitive advantage?" DAP's Tony Pua had asked.
Azman had previously called on the MB to cancel his trip and focus on helping the poor in the state.
Terengganu deputy PAS commissioner Yahaya Ali said the issue of who is the organiser is not important but the the trip should be cancelled as it did not bring any benefit.
"At a time when we are asking the people to tighten their belts, the MB is seen as wanting to spend money without any good.
"What will the people of Terengganu get from his trip to the Antartica? It's not like we have snow here. What we have are floods," he told The Malaysian Insider.
Azman said not only was the Antartica trip shocking but the YDSM's denial of being involved was even more surprising.
"It was a blatant lie to the people," he told The Malaysian Insider.
He said he was confident that the people of Terengganu will not sit back and let the MB's lie just slide.
"I am sure the people, without looking at political affiliations, will not let this go just like that," Azman, who is also in the PAS central committee said.
Ahmad Said's position had not been stable since he was elected as Menteri Besar after the 2008 general election.
This was because the Umno leadership had initially chosen Datuk Seri Idris Jusoh to take the position but the suggestion was shot down by the palace.
Said was finally installed as the MB after several negotiations with the palace.
When Tuanku Sultan Mizan was appointed as King, a Dewan Pangkuan DiRaja Terengganu (DPDRT) was formed to replace him in the state as his son was too young to be acting Sultan.
Following that, Said was accountable not only to one ruler but nine members of the DPDRT in the state administration.
This had created the perception that many projects, timber and mining areas "escaped" from the people's hands to certain parties.
After the 2013 general election, Ahmad Said's position became even weaker as the state opposition only had two less seats than the ruling Barisan Nasional.
Pakatan Rakyat obtained 15 seats while BN got 17 seats. – January 28, 2014.

Anwar mahu jadi MB Selangor kerana gagal jadi PM, kata Kadir Jasin The Malaysian Insider


Datuk A Kadir Jasin berkata tindakan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im bertanding di kerusi Dewan Undangan Negeri (DUN) Kajang yang dikosongkan semalam akan dilihat sebagai satu pengakuan kalah kerana gagal menjadi perdana menteri Malaysia.
Bekas Ketua Pengarang Kumpulan New Straits Times Press (NSTP) itu mengulas spekulasi mengatakan Anwar bakal menggantikan Tan Sri Abdul Khalid Ibrahim sebagai menteri besar Selangor jika menang di kerusi DUN Kajang dalam pilihan raya kecil yang perlu diadakan selepas Lee Chin Cheh meletakkan jawatan semalam.
"Beliau pasti dituduh oleh musuhnya sebagai mengaku kalah dan tidak yakin lagi boleh menjadi PM," tulis Kadir dalam blognya hari ini.
"Anwar membuat pengorbanan besar kerana matlamat beliau selama ini, bermula dengan penyertaannya dalam Umno pada 1982 adalah menjadi perdana menteri,” katanya.
Abdul Khalid pada satu sidang media di ibu pejabat PKR di Petaling Jaya hari ini mengumumkan Anwar sebagai calon PKR bagi kerusi DUN Kajang.
Menurut wartawan veteran itu lagi, tindakan Anwar memulakan langkah untuk mengambil alih jawatan Abdul Khalid itu sudah pasti akan mencetuskan reaksi negatif.
"Antaranya ialah beliau bukan kelahiran Selangor dan usianya (66 tahun) adalah agak lanjut bagi seorang MB.
"Akhirnya Anwar terpaksa mengaku bahawa krisis kepimpinan kerajaan Selangor yang berpunca daripada perebutan kuasa antara Abdul Khalid dan Timbalan Presiden PKR, Mohamed Azmin Ali, sudah sampai ke peringkat hidup mati," katanya.
Lee dalam satu kenyataan kepada The Malaysian Insider semalam, berkata: "Keputusan saya untuk mengosongkan kerusi DUN N25 Kajang adalah untuk kepentingan bersama dan mengukuhkan kebolehan Pakatan Rakyat berkhidmat untuk rakyat Selangor."
 Surat peletakan jawatan Lee diserahkan kepada Speaker DUN Selangor, Hannah Yeoh semalam.
Lee, 42, merupakan seorang peguam dan bekas ahli parti Gerakan selama 10 tahun. Dalam PRU13, Lee mendapat 19,571 undi berbanding calon Barisan Nasional Lee Ban Seng yang mendapat 12,747 undi.
Sebelum ini, ada sumber memberitahu Lee meletakkan jawatan bagi memberi laluan kepada Anwar bertanding di kerusi itu bagi membolehkan beliau menjadi menteri besar Selangor menggantikan Abdul Khalid.
Keseluruhan senario itu berlaku selepas kemelut perbalahan antara Abdul Khalid dan Azmin tidak bertemu jalan perdamaian menyebabkan Anwar terpaksa mengambil langkah mencari penyelesaiannya. – 28 Januari, 2014.

Pergolakan dalam keluarga Tun Razak The Malaysian Insider


Artikel bertajuk “Mengenang kembali bapa saya, Tun Razak” yang ditulis jurubank terkemuka Datuk Seri Nazir Razak dikatakan menyebabkan kemarahan keluarga perdana menteri dan penyokongnya -  dengan kemungkinan akan menyebabkan bos CIMB itu menerima akibatnya.
Menurut kem Datuk Seri Najib Razak, artikel tersebut yang menggambarkan legasi perdana menteri kedua Malaysia ibarat memberikan peluru kepada musuh beliau – kini menyerang dirinya dan isteri daripada pelbagai sudut.
Dalam artikel dikeluarkan sempena ulang tahun ke-38 kematian Tun Abdul Razak Hussein, Nazir meceritakan tentang kualiti yang menyebabkan bapanya dihormati. Sebagai seorang pemegang amanah aset negara, kesederhanaannya adalah lagenda.
Apabila keluarga menemaninya dalam lawatan rasmi kerajaan, Tun Razak memastikan perbelanjaan untuk keluarga daripada poketnya sendiri. Beliau juga terkenal dengan integriti, merupakan hamba kepada rakyat dan kepercayaan diberikan mestilah tidak boleh dikhianati.
Nazir berkata, bapanya sudah melaksanakan "Rakyat Didahulukan", sebelum slogan tersebut kedengaran dan percaya terdapat tempat bagi semua rakyat di bawah matahari Malaysia.
Difahamkan, artikel tersebut dikeluarkan untuk mengingatkan rakyat Malaysia mengenai legasi Razak dan juga mempertahankan nama keluarganya.
Artikel tersebut disukai ramai terutama yang tidak gembira dengan pencapaian Najib sebagai perdana menteri serta membiarkan peningkatan ektremisme kaum dan agama.
Ramai beranggapan artikel tersebut dikeluarkan tepat pada masanya di kala kerajaan berbelanja secara mewah dan sikap angkuh ahli politik pemerintah pada ketika rakyat Malaysia menderita akibat kenaikan kos kehidupan.
Tetapi di Putrajaya, artikel tersebut tidak disukai dan Nazir kini terpinggir daripada koridor kuasa.
Beliau kini tidak menikmati sokongan kerajaan sehingga terpaksa memikirkan pilihan pekerjaannya.
Wujud cakap-cakap mengatakan Nazir dilihat sebagai pengkhianat.
Apa yang pasti, hubungan di antara keluarga Najib dan penyokongnya dengan pengurus bank itu semakin dingin.
Sumber dekat memberitahu The Malaysian Insider terdapat banyak penentangan terhadap artikel tersebut termasuk nada tulisan, masa dikeluarkan dan motif di belakangnya.
Kumpulan Najib berkata, seolah-olah hanya Nazir yang menjaga legasi Razak. Sebagai tambahan mereka berkata, perlu ada kesetiaan kepada keluarga, terutamanya pada waktu sukar.
Dan mesej kepada perdana menteri dihantar melalui artikel disiarkan media tidak dikawal Umno. Artikel bertarikh 14 Januari itu disiarkan The Malaysian Insider, The Star dan Sinar Harian.
Difahamkan Najib dan adiknya bertengkar mengenai artikel tersebut, dan sebuah lagi artikel tentang isu sama disiarkan akhbar milik Umno New Straits Times, dua hari kemudian.
Walaupun diserang penulis blog pro kerajaan berhubung artikel tersebut, Nazir tidak berganjak dan mempercayai beliau mempunyai tanggungjawab kepada keluarganya untuk mengingatkan rakyat Malaysia mengenai legasi ayahnya dan mempertahankannya walau apa pun terjadi.
Walau apa pun terjadi. – 28 Januari, 2014.


All is not well with the Razak clan



An opinion piece titled Remembering Tun Razak by prominent banker Datuk Seri Nazir Razak (pic) appears to have struck a raw nerve with the First Family and their supporters – with possible dire consequences for the CIMB boss.
The consensus in the Datuk Seri Najib Razak camp is the article, which sketched the legacy of Malaysia's second prime minister, was ill-advised and served only to provide ammunition for the Prime Minister's opponents at a time when arrows are being fired at him and his wife from all sides.
In the article to coincide with the 38th anniversary of Tun Abdul Razak Hussein's death, Nazir outlined the qualities that made his father a much respected figure. As the custodian of the nation's coffers, his frugality was legendary.
On the rare occasions when his family travelled with him, Razak made sure that he paid for the expenses himself. He was also famous for his integrity and understood that he was a servant of the people whose trust must never be betrayed.
Nazir pointed out that his father was "People First", long before the sound bite, and believed that there was a place under the Malaysian sun for every one of its citizens.
It is understood that the piece was put out to remind Malaysians of the Razak legacy and also to protect the family name.
It found favour with many in the chattering class who have grown despondent over Najib's lacklustre performance as a prime minister and the downward drift of the country into a deep and dark abyss of religious and racial extremism.
Many considered the article timely given the roiling debate of lavish spending by the government and the seemingly cavalier attitude by ruling politicians towards hardship faced by Malaysians due to rising cost of living.
But in Putrajaya, the opinion piece was received poorly and it is no stretch of imagination to say that Nazir is persona non grata in the corridors of power.
Punitive action being bandied about range from making it clear that he does not enjoy the favour of the government to forcing him to consider his employment options.
Much of the talk could be just hyperbole, fuelled by a sense of betrayal. But what is clear is that ties between the First Family and their supporters and the banker have never been so strained.
Well-placed sources told The Malaysian Insider that there were many objections over the article and this included the lecturing tone, its timing and the motive behind it.
It was as if only Nazir was concerned about the Razak legacy, complained Team Najib. In addition, they felt that there must be a sense of loyalty to family, especially during difficult times.
And that sending a message to the PM through an opinion piece was out of order, particularly as it appeared in media not controlled by Umno.
The article dated January 14 was carried by The Malaysian Insider, The Star and Sinar Harian.
It is learnt that Najib and his younger brother have exchanged words about the opinion piece, with another piece, seen as more conciliatory, on the same issue coming out in the Umno-owned New Straits Times two days later.
Despite sniping by pro-government bloggers over the piece, Nazir is unmoved, believing that he owes a duty to his family to remind Malaysians of his father's legacy and protect it at all cost.
At all cost. – January 28, 2014.

$$$ is not everything



NEW YORK (Reuters) – The son of billionaire investor Warren Buffett has an old-world spiritual message for today's money-rich parents: teach your children values and do not give them everything they want.

Musician and now author Peter Buffett preaches the message in his new book "Life is What You Make it: Finding Your Own Path to Fulfillment". Recently released in the United States, it describes how he wound up a "normal, happy" person instead of a spoiled child to one of the world's richest people.

Buffett, 52, teaches the rewards of self-respect and pursuing one's own passions and accomplishments rather than buying into society's concepts of material wealth.

"I am my own person and I know what I have accomplished in my life," he said. "This isn't about wealth or fame or money or any of that stuff, it is actually about values and what you enjoy and finding something you love doing."

People who are born with a silver spoon in their mouth can fall victim to what Buffett said his father has called a "silver dagger in your back," which leads to a sense of entitlement and a lack of personal achievement.

"Entitlement is the worst thing ever and I see entitlement coming in many guises," he said. "Anybody who acts like they deserve something 'just because,', is a disaster."

But Buffett wasn't always this wise. His own family gave him $90,000 in stock when he was 19, a small sum from such immense financial wealth. After studying at Stanford University, he moved to San Francisco and lived in a studio apartment with just enough room for his musical instruments.

"I was really searching," he said, adding that he began his musical career by working for free writing music for a local television station.

"I was kind of lost, but trying to find myself. It was definitely this strange period where I didn't really know where I was going," he said.

LOOKING AT THE BIG PICTURE

As well his musical passions, the values taught to him growing up and a sense of a bigger picture in life stayed with him during those trying times, he said.

"I was not only not handed everything as a kid, I was shown that there are lots of other people out there with very different circumstances," he said.

Although many people he encounters assume that his father wanted him to go into finance, he said his father accepted his choice to become a musician beginning with commercials then his own albums and composing for television shows and films.

"It was encouraged for a moment when I was open to the idea," he said about pursuing finance. But he added that as he grew older, it became clear the financial world "was not speaking to my heart."

Along with the book, Buffett has embarked on a "Concert & Conversation" tour in which he plays the piano, talks about his life and warns against consumerist culture and damaging the environment.

He said he eventually inherited more money after his mother died in 2004, but by then he had learned his lessons. Now he works on giving back to the world -- another of his life philosophies -- which includes through working for his father's NoVo charitable foundation.

"Economic prosperity may come and go; that's just how it is," he writes in the book. "But values are the steady currency that earn us the all-important rewards."
